目的:观察隔药灸改善UC大鼠结肠炎症的效应,通过NF-κB通路和STAT3磷酸化参与免疫调节的作用机制。方法:将大鼠随机分成正常组、UC组和隔药灸组,每组8只。采用4% DSS诱导UC的大鼠模型,造模成功后采用隔药灸大鼠双侧天枢穴,每穴灸2壮艾炷,每天1次,共7次。通过比较组织病理学、血清学促炎症因子的蛋白浓度观察隔药灸干预UC大鼠的效应。采用Western Blot检测结肠组织NF-κB通路及STAT3活性探讨隔药灸改善UC大鼠结肠炎症反应的潜在机制。结果:UC组大鼠结肠组织病理学提示黏膜上皮表面溃疡形成,炎症反应明显,隔药灸能修复结肠上皮损伤,减轻UC大鼠结肠组织的炎症反应。与正常组比较,UC组大鼠血清IL-1β和IL-6蛋白浓度显著升高(P < 0.05,P < 0.01),p-STAT3磷酸化水平显著增加,pIκB-α和NF-κB p65蛋白表达均显著增加,IκB-α蛋白表达显著降低;与UC组比较,隔药灸组大鼠血清IL-1β和IL-6蛋白浓度显著降低(P < 0.05),结肠组织NF-κB p65蛋白表达和pIκB-α磷酸化水平均降低,IκB-α蛋白表达增加。结论:隔药灸可能通过抑制NF-κB通路和STAT3磷酸化,减少了促炎症因子IL-1β和IL-6的释放,从而减轻了UC大鼠的结肠炎症反应。  相似文献

目的:观察隔药灸对肿瘤坏死因子-α(TNF-α)-肿瘤坏死因子受体相关死亡结构域(TRADD)-Fas相关的死亡结构域(FADD)途径介导克罗恩病(Crohn's disease,CD)肠上皮细胞凋亡的影响,探讨其作用机制。方法:将48只SD雄性大鼠随机分成正常组、模型组、隔药灸组和西药组,每组12只。采用2,4,6-三硝基苯磺酸(TNBS)制备CD模型,造模成功后隔药灸组采用隔药饼灸"天枢""气海"穴,每日1次,每次每穴隔药灸2壮,共灸10d。西药组采用美沙拉嗪灌胃,每日2次,每次2mL,共灌胃10d。治疗结束后取各组大鼠结肠上皮组织,分离、纯化和培养结肠上皮细胞建立体外肠上皮细胞屏障模型,将100ng/mL TNF-α分别与各组肠上皮细胞孵育培养24h,应用荧光黄透过率检测各组肠上皮细胞屏障通透性,Western blot法检测各组肠上皮细胞凋亡途径相关蛋白肿瘤坏死因子受体1(TNFR1)、TRADD、受体作用蛋白1(RIP1)、FADD、锌指蛋白A20(A20)表达以及流式细胞术观察各组肠上皮细胞凋亡情况。结果:与正常组比较,模型组的荧光黄透过率显著升高(P0.001),结肠上皮细胞TNFR1、TRADD、RIP1表达量明显升高(P0.01),A20表达量明显降低(P0.01),细胞凋亡率显著增高(P0.001)。与模型组比较,隔药灸组和西药组的荧光黄透过率显著降低(P0.001),结肠上皮细胞TRADD、RIP1、FADD表达量明显降低(P0.01),A20表达量明显升高(P0.01),结肠上皮细胞凋亡率显著降低(P0.001)。结论:隔药灸可能是通过调控TNF-α介导CD肠上皮细胞凋亡途径的异常,达到保护或修复CD肠上皮屏障损伤之效应。  相似文献

Objective

To evaluate and compare electroacupunctures (EA) with different parameters and moxibustion at different temperatures influencing the activation of mast cells (MC) in Tianshu (ST 25) regions of visceral hyperalgesia model rats.

Methods

Rats (except for model group) respectively accepted 1 mA or 3 mA EA or moxibustion at 43 °C or 4 °C to stimulate Tianshu (ST 25) points after randomization of the fifty visceral hyperalgesia model rats, and then were compared with that in model and normal groups. Number, degranulation numbers, degranulation rates in Tianshu (ST 25) regions MC of rats in each group were observed using toluidine blue staining. Abdominal withdrawl reflex (AWR) score was used to evaluate the rat visceral hyperalgesia reactions.

Results

Compared with the normal group and the model group, MC numbers (P<0.05, P<0.01, P<0.01, P<0.01), degranulation numbers and degranulation rates (P<0.01, P<0.01, P<0.05, P<0.01) of Tianshu (ST 25) MC in regions tissues in 43 °C and 4 °C moxibustion groups, and 1 mA and 3 mA EA groups all increased significantly. Compared with the model group, AWR scores were significantly lower in 43 °C and 4 °C moxibustion groups, and 1 mA and 3 mA EA groups under the stimulation of 20 mmHg, 40 mmHg, 0 mmHg or 80 mmHg colorectal distension (CRD) (P<0.05 in 1 mA and 3 mA EA groups under the stimulation of 20 mmHg, P<0.01 in the other groups). AWR scores in 43 °C and 4 °C oxibustion groups under the stimulation of 20 mmHg, 40 mmHg, 0 mmHg or 80 mmHg CRD were not significantly different from those in the normal group (all P>0.05); AWR scores in 1 mA EA group under the stimulation of 0 mmHg or 80 mmHg were significantly higher than that in the normal group (P<0.01); AWR score in 3 mA EA group under the stimulation of 0 mmHg was significantly higher than that in the normal group (P<0.01), and AWR scores in 3 mA EA group under the stimulation of 20 mmHg or 80 mmHg were also higher than that in the normal group (P<0.05). AWR scores were higher in 1 mA EA group under the stimulation of 40 mmHg or 80 mmHg than that in 4 °C moxibustion group (P<0.05); AWR score was higher in 3 mA EA group under the stimulation of 40 mmHg than that in 4 °C moxibustion group (P<0.05).

Conclusion

There are differences among EA of different parameters and moxibustion of different temperatures in activating on Tianshu (ST 25) regions MC of visceral hyperalgesia model rats, as well as in improving the visceral hyperalgesia reaction. The effect of 4 °C moxibustion is the most significant.

Objective

To investigate the influence of moxibustion products on mitochondrial transmembrane potential (MTP) and mRNA expression of Bax/Bcl-2 in alveolar type II epithelial A549 cells, and to further explore influence of moxibustion products on the oxidative damage of A549 cells.

Methods

Smoke and particles generated by moxibustion were collected using the filter box for gas sampling. The moxa smoke extract (MSE) was diluted sequentially to the final concentrations of 0.05 mg/mL, 0.1 mg/mL, 0.2 mg/mL, 0.3 mg/mL and 0.4 mg/mL using the cell culture medium, and A549 cells were then intervened by the above MSE solution. Cell MTP was detected by JC-1 staining. Fluorescence quantitative polymerase chain reaction (PCR) was used to detect Bax/Bcl-2 mRNA expression of A549 cells.

Results

Compared with cells in the normal control group, MTP was significantly decreased in cells of 0.3 mg/mL and 0.4 mg/mL MSE intervention groups (P<0.01); while MTP showed no significant changes in cells of 0.05 mg/mL, 0.1 mg/mL and 0.2 mg/mL MSE intervention groups (P>0.05); compared with cells in 0.05 mg/mL MSE intervention group, MTP was decreased significantly in cells of 0.1 mg/mL, 0.2 mg/mL, 0.3 mg/mL and 0.4 mg/mL MSE intervention groups (P<0.05 ); compared with cells in 0.1 mg/mL MSE intervention group, MTP was decreased significantly in cells of 0.4 mg/mL MSE intervention group (P<0.01). Bax mRNA expression of cells in each concentration of MSE intervention group all showed no significant difference compared to that in the normal control group; Bcl-2 mRNA expression of cells was reduced with the increase of MSE intervention concentration. Wherein, Bcl-2 mRNA expressions of cells in 0.4 mg/mL and 0.3 mg/mL MSE intervention groups were significantly reduced compared with that of cells in the normal control group (P<0.05); Bcl-2 mRNA expression of cells in 0.4 mg/mL MSE intervention group was significantly reduced compared to that in 0.05 mg/mL MSE intervention group (P<0.05).

Conclusion

Certain higher concentration of moxa smoke could reduce MTP and mRNA expression of the anti-apoptosis gene Bcl-2 in alveolar type II epithelial A549 cells. Oxidative damage may be the important mechanism of apoptosis caused by the high concentration of moxa smoke solution, and further studies are necessary on the specific mechanisms.

目的:从维生素D参与免疫调节作用角度探讨隔药灸治疗UC的作用机制。方法:采用4%葡聚糖硫酸钠制备UC大鼠模型。将动物随机分为:正常组、模型组、隔药灸组和SASP组。观察各组大鼠DAI评分、结肠大体形态损伤评分及结肠组织病理学(HPS)评分、大鼠血清及结肠组织25(OH)D3、VDR浓度;检测大鼠结肠组织炎性细胞因子IFN-γ、TNF-α的表达和大鼠结肠组织VDR、RXRα mRNA的表达;分析25(OH)D3与治疗后DAI评分、结肠IFN-γ、TNF-α表达之间的相关性。结果:隔药灸显著降低UC大鼠DAI评分、结肠大体形态损伤评分及HPS评分(P<0.05);隔药灸显著升高UC大鼠血清和结肠中25(OH)D3、VDR浓度(P<0.05),以及结肠组织中VDR、RXRαmRNA表达(P<0.05);隔药灸降低UC大鼠结肠组织中IFN-γ、TNF-α表达水平(P<0.05)。大鼠血清25(OH)D3浓度与治疗后DAI评分呈负相关,结肠25(OH)D3浓度分别与结肠IFN-γ、TNF-α表达呈显著负相关。结论:隔药灸可抑制UC大鼠结肠IFN-γ、TNF-α的表达,升高其血清和结肠中的维生素D及其受体的浓度;UC大鼠肠道炎症与低浓度的维生素D呈负相关。  相似文献

Objective

To investigate the efficacy and mechanisms of moxibustion-based treatment of chronic gastritis (CG), and to provide an objective basis for treating CG using moxibustion.

Methods

A total of 61 CG patients were divided into an herbal cake-partitioned moxibustion group and a mild-warm moxibustion group. In both treatment groups, bilateral Tianshu (ST 25), Zhongwan (CV 12) and Qihai (CV 6) were selected for moxibustion. Before and after treatment, all the enrolled patients’ gastrointestinal disease-related traditional Chinese medicine (TCM) syndrome scores and visual analog scale (VAS) scores were measured, and the changes in the serum levels of the brain-gut peptides ghrelin, somatostatin (SS) and motilin (MTL) were observed.

Results

There was no statistically significant difference between the two groups in the clinical efficacy rate (P>0.05). After treatment, the gastrointestinal disease-related TCM syndrome scores and VAS scores were reduced to varying extents in both groups, the intra-group differences were statistically significant (all P<0.01). In both groups, the serum levels of ghrelin and MTL increased and the serum levels of SS decreased after treatment (all P<0.01). And there were no serious adverse events occurred.

Conclusion

Both herbal cake-partitioned moxibustion and mild-warm moxibustion are effective for CG; these two therapies exhibited similar therapeutic efficacy of epigastric discomfort or pain. And both the two therapies act to anti-inflammation, promote the recovery of gastric mucosa and improve the gastric motility, which is possibly their crucial action mechanism in treating CD.

Objective

To categorize and summarize the clinical and mechanism studies of the past 30 years on the treatment of Hashimoto’s thyroiditis (HT) with moxibustion, moxibustion plus medication, and acupuncture plus medication, etc., and to analyze the current problems.

Methods

The clinical and laboratory studies related to the treatment of HT with acupuncture-moxibustion therapies published before June 2015 were retrieved from MEDLINE, Excerpta Medica Database (EMBASE), China National Knowledge Infrastructure (CNKI), Wanfang Academic Journal Full-text Database (Wanfang) and Chongqing VIP Database (CQVIP).

Results

Moxibustion, moxibustion plus medication, and acupuncture plus medication can produce certain therapeutic effects in treating HT.

Conclusion

The research on the treatment of HT with acupuncture-moxibustion therapies is rather limited in the amount and content. In the future, standardization should be fortified, specific moxibustion research needs deepening, and the action mechanism of moxibustion should be emphasized.

目的 观察电针结合天癸胶囊治疗肥胖型多囊卵巢综合征(PCOS)的临床疗效.方法 将67例PCOS患者随机分为针药结合组33例和单纯电针组34例.单纯电针组取天枢、中脘、气海、三阴交、膈俞、次鼹等为主穴,采用电针治疗,每周治疗3次,1个月为1个疗程,共3个疗程后观察效果;针药结合组在此基础上同时口服天癸胶囊,每日2次,每次1.8g,连服3个月.比较两组治疗前后促卵泡刺激素(FSH)、促黄体生成素(LH)、睾酮(T)、空腹血糖(FPG)、空腹胰岛素(FINS)和胰岛素敏感指数( ISI)的变化,并观察临床疗效及3个月随访复发率.结果 针药结合组临床疗效总有效率93.9%,单纯电针组总有效率67.6%,针药结合组疗效优于单纯电针组(P<0.05);针药结合组LH、LH/FSH、T值的降低明显优于单纯电针组(P<0.01);针药结合组降低FINS及ISI水平也明显优于单纯电针组(P<0.01);两组治疗后3个月随访,针药结合组复发率少于单纯电针组(P<0.05). 结论 针药结合治疗肥胖型PCOS临床疗效肯定,可能与降低患者性激素及胰岛素水平有关.  相似文献
